  • 3Post-Departure Trip InterruptionWe will pay a Post-Departure Trip Interruption Benefit, up tothe amount in the Schedule, if: 1) Your arrival on yourCovered Trip is delayed beyond the Scheduled DepartureDate; or 2) You are unable to continue on your Covered Tripafter you have departed on your Covered Trip due to your,Family Member's or Traveling Companion's, Sickness,Injury, or death. For item 1) above, the Sickness or Injurymust: a) Commence while your coverage is in effect underthe plan; b) For item 2 above, commence while you are onyour Covered Trip and your coverage is in effect under theplan; and c) For both items 1 and 2 above, require theexamination and treatment by a Physician, in person, at thetime the Covered Trip is interrupted or delayed; and d) Inthe written opinion of the treating Physician, be so disablingas to delay your arrival on your Covered Trip or to preventyou from continuing your Covered Trip.

    We will pay a benefit if: 1) Your arrival on your CoveredTrip is delayed beyond the Scheduled Departure Date; or2) You are unable to continue on your Covered Trip afteryou have departed on your Covered Trip due to OtherCovered Events, as defined.

    We will reimburse you, less any refund paid or payable, forunused land or water travel arrangements, plus one of thefollowing:

    1. The additional transportation expenses by the mostdirect route from the point you interrupted your CoveredTrip:

    a. To the next scheduled destination where you can catchup to your Covered Trip; or

    b. To the final destination of your Covered Trip; or

    2. The additional transportation expenses incurred by youby the most direct route to reach your original Covered Tripdestination if you are delayed and leave after the ScheduledDeparture Date.

    However, the benefit payable under 1 and 2 above will notexceed the cost of a one-way economy air fare (or firstclass, if the original tickets were first class) by the mostdirect route less any refunds paid or payable for yourunused original tickets.

    3. Your additional cost as a result of a change in the per-person occupancy rate for prepaid travel arrangements if aTraveling Companion's Covered Trip is interrupted and yourCovered Trip is continued.

    Travel DelayIf your Covered Trip is delayed for 12 hours or more, we willreimburse you, up to the amount shown in the Schedule forreasonable additional expenses incurred by you for hotelaccommodations, meals, telephone calls and localtransportation while you are delayed. We will not pay benefitsfor expenses incurred after travel becomes possible.

    Travel Delay must be caused by or result from: CommonCarrier delay; or loss or theft of your passport(s), travel

    documents or money; or quarantine; or hijacking; or naturaldisaster; or closure of public roadways by governmentauthorities due to adverse weather; or a documented trafficaccident while you are en route to departure; orunannounced strike; or a civil disorder; or you, a FamilyMember traveling with you, or a Traveling Companion'sInjury or Sickness; or a Family Member traveling with you ora Traveling Companion's death.

    Accidental Death and DismembermentWe will pay this benefit up to the amount on the Schedule ifyou are injured in an Accident which occurs while you are ona Covered Trip and covered under the plan, and you sufferone of the losses listed below within 365 days of theAccident. The Principal Sum is the benefit amount shown onthe Schedule.

    We will pay 100% of the principal sum for the loss of: life;both hands or feet, or sight of both eyes; one hand and onefoot; or one hand or one foot and sight of one eye. We willpay 50% of the principal sum for loss of: one hand or onefoot, or sight of one eye.

    If you suffer more than one loss from one Accident, we willpay only for the loss with the larger benefit. Loss of a handor foot means complete severance at or above the wrist orankle joint. Loss of sight of an eye means complete andirrecoverable loss of sight.

    Exposure and DisappearanceIf by reason of an Accident covered by the certificate, youare unavoidably exposed to the elements and as a result ofsuch exposure suffer a loss for which benefits areotherwise payable, such loss shall be covered hereunder.

    If you are involved in an Accident which results in thesinking or wrecking of a conveyance in which you were ridingand your body is not located within one year of suchAccident, it will be presumed that you suffered loss of liferesulting from Injury caused by the Accident.

    Baggage and Personal Effects BenefitWe will reimburse you, less any amount paid or payablefrom any Other Valid and Collectible Insurance or indemnity,up to the amount shown in the Schedule, for direct loss,theft, damage or destruction of your Baggage, passports orvisas during your Covered Trip. We will also pay for loss dueto unauthorized use of your credit cards, if you havecomplied with all of the credit card conditions imposed bythe credit card companies.

    Valuation and Payment of LossPayment of loss under the Baggage and Personal EffectsBenefit will be calculated based upon an Actual Cash Valuebasis. For items without receipts, payment of loss will becalculated based upon 75% of the Actual Cash Value at thetime of loss. At our option, we may elect to repair or replaceyour Baggage. We will notify you within 30 days after wereceive your proof of loss.

    We may take all or part of damaged Baggage as a conditionfor payment of loss. In the event of a loss to a pair or set ofitems, we will: 1) Repair or replace any part to restore thepair or set to its value before the loss; or 2) Pay thedifference between the value of the property before andafter the loss.

    Continuation of CoverageIf the covered Baggage, passports or visas are in thecustody of a Common Carrier, and delivery is delayed, thiscoverage will continue until the property is delivered to you.This continuation of coverage does not include loss causedby or resulting from the delay.

    Items Not CoveredWe will not pay for damage to or loss of: animals; propertyused in trade, business or for the production of income;household furniture; musical instruments; brittle or fragilearticles; sporting equipment if the loss results from the usethereof; boats; motors; motorcycles; motor vehicles;aircraft; other conveyances or equipment, or parts for suchconveyances; artificial limbs or other prosthetic devices;artificial teeth; dental bridges; dentures; dental braces;retainers or other orthodontic devices; hearing aids; anytype of eyeglasses, sunglasses or contact lenses;

    6

    documents or tickets, except for administrative feesrequired to reissue tickets; money; stamps; stocks andbonds; postal or money orders; securities; accounts; bills;deeds; food stamps; credit cards, except as noted above;property shipped as freight or shipped prior to theScheduled Departure Date; or contraband.

    Losses Not CoveredWe will not pay for loss arising from: defective materials orcraftsmanship; or normal wear and tear, gradualdeterioration, inherent vice; or rodents, animals, insects orvermin; or mysterious disappearance; or electrical current,including electric arcing that damages or destroys electricaldevices or appliances.

    Your Duties in the Event of a LossIn case of loss, theft or damage to Baggage and personaleffects, you should: 1) Immediately report the situationincident to the hotel manager, tour guide or representative,transportation official, local police or other local authoritiesand obtain their written report of your loss; and 2) Takereasonable steps to protect your Baggage from furtherdamage, and make necessary, reasonable and temporaryrepairs. We will reimburse you for these expenses. We willnot pay for further damage if you fail to protect yourBaggage.

    Baggage Delay BenefitWe will reimburse you up to the amount shown in theSchedule for the cost of reasonable additional clothing andpersonal articles purchased by you, if your Baggage isdelayed for 24 hours or more during your Covered Trip.

    DEFINITIONS

    In this Policy, "you", "your" and "yours" refer to the Insured."We", "us" and "our" refer to the company providing thiscoverage. In addition, certain words and phrases aredefined as follows:

    ACCIDENT means a sudden, unexpected, unintended andexternal event, which causes Injury.

    ACTUAL CASH VALUE means purchase price lessdepreciation.

    COMMON CARRIER means any land, water or airconveyance operated under a license for the transportationof passengers for hire, not including taxicabs or rented,leased or privately owned motor vehicles.

    BAGGAGE means luggage, personal possessions and traveldocuments taken by you on the Covered Trip.

    COVERED TRIP means: 1) A period of round-trip travel awayfrom Home to a destination outside your city of residence; thepurpose of the trip is business or pleasure and is not to obtainhealth care or treatment of any kind; the trip has defineddeparture and return dates specified when the Insured enrolls;the trip does not exceed 365 days or, 2) A period of one-waytravel that starts in the US or Canada (except US citizens maybegin their trip outside the US, if returning to the US); the

    7

    purpose of the trip is business or pleasure and is not to obtainhealth care or treatment of any kind; the trip has defineddeparture and arrival dates and defined departure and arrivalplaces specified when the Insured enrolls; and the trip doesnot exceed 31 days in length.

    DOMESTIC PARTNER means a person who is at leasteighteen years of age and you can show: 1) Evidence offinancial interdependence, such as joint bank accounts orcredit cards, jointly owned property, and mutual lifeinsurance or pension beneficiary designations; 2) Evidenceof cohabitation for at least the previous 6 months; and 3)An affidavit of domestic partnership if recognized by thejurisdiction within which they reside.

    ELECTIVE TREATMENT AND PROCEDURES means anymedical treatment or surgical procedure that is notmedically necessary including any service, treatment, orsupplies that are deemed by the federal, or a state or localgovernment authority, or by us to be research orexperimental or that is not recognized as a generallyaccepted medical practice.

    FAMILY MEMBER includes your or your TravelingCompanion's dependent, spouse, child, spouse's child,son/daughter-in-law, parent(s), sibling(s), brother/sister,grandparent(s), grandchild, step-brother/sister, step-parent(s), parent(s)-in-law, brother/sister-in-law, guardian,Domestic Partner, foster child, or ward.

    FINANCIAL INSOLVENCY means the total cessation orcomplete suspension of operations due to insolvency, withor without the filing of a bankruptcy petition, or the totalcessation or complete suspension of operations followingthe filing of a bankruptcy petition, whether voluntary orinvoluntary, by a tour operator, cruise line, airline, rental carcompany, hotel, condominium, railroad, motor coachcompany, or other supplier of travel services which is dulylicensed in the state(s) of operation other than the entity orthe person, organization, agency or firm from whom youdirectly purchased or paid for your Covered Trip provided theFinancial Insolvency occurs more than 7 days following youreffective date for the Trip Cancellation Benefits. There is nocoverage for the total cessation or complete suspension ofoperations for losses caused by fraud or negligentmisrepresentation by the supplier of travel services.

    HOME means your primary or secondary residence.

    HOSPITAL means an institution, which meets all of thefollowing requirements:

    1. It must be operated according to law;

    2. It must give 24-hour medical care, diagnosis andtreatment to the sick or injured on an inpatient basis;

    3. It must provide diagnostic and surgical facilitiessupervised by Physicians;

    4. Registered nurses must be on 24-hour call or duty; and

    5. The care must be given either on the hospital's premises orin facilities available to the hospital on a pre-arranged basis.

    GENERAL PROVISIONSArbitration If we and you disagree on the amount of loss,either may make written demand for arbitration. In thisevent, each party will select a competent and impartialarbitrator. The two arbitrators will select a third. If theycannot agree within 30 days, either may request thatselection be made by a judge of a court having jurisdiction.Each party will (1) Pay the expense if incurred and (2) Bearthe expenses of the third arbitrator equally. A decisionagreed to by two arbitrators will be binding.

    Concealment or Fraud We do not provide coverage if youhave intentionally concealed or misrepresented any materialfact or circumstance relating to the coverage plan.

    Conformity to Law Any provision of the plan that is inconflict with the laws of the state in which it is issued isamended to conform with the laws of that state.

    Duplication of Coverage You may only purchase onecertificate from us for each Covered Trip. If you do purchasemore than one certificate for a specific Covered Trip, theMaximum Limit of Coverage payable will be as specified inthe certificate with the highest level of benefits. We willrefund plan payments received from you under any othercertificate.

    Entire Contract Any statement you make is arepresentation and not a warranty. No statement will beused by us to void or reduce benefits unless that statementis a part of any written application or enrollment form.

    The plan may be changed at any time by written agreementbetween us. Only our President, Vice President or Secretarymay change or waive the provisions of the policy plan. Noagent or other person may change the policy plan or waiveany of its terms. The change will be endorsed on the policyplan.

    Examination Under Oath As often as we may reasonablyrequire, you or any person making a claim under the planmust submit to examination under oath.

    Maximum Limit of Coverage The maximum benefit amountfor each claim is listed in the Schedule or enrollment form,subject to the individual benefit amount and the company'sMaximum Limit of Liability. The total limit of our liability forany one covered event, in which two or more personssubmit a claim, is subject to the individual benefit amountand the company's Maximum Limit of Liability. In the eventof multiple claims by you for one event, the available fundswill be distributed in order of notice of claim by eachinsured subject to the above limitations.

    13

    Our Right to Recover From Others We have the right torecover any payments we have made from anyone who maybe responsible for the loss. You and anyone else we insuremust sign any papers and do whatever is necessary totransfer this right to us. You and anyone else we insure willdo nothing after the loss to affect our rights.

    CLAIMS PROVISIONS

    Notice of Claim We must be given written notice of claimwithin 90 days after a covered loss occurs. If notice cannotbe given within that time, it must be given as soon asreasonably possible. Notice may be given to us or to ourauthorized agent. Notice should include the claimant'sname and enough information to identify him or her.

    Proof of Loss Written Proof of Loss must be sent to uswithin 90 days after the date the loss occurs. We will notreduce or deny a claim if it was not reasonably possible togive us written Proof of Loss within the time allowed. In anyevent, you must give us written Proof of Loss within twelve(12) months after the date the loss occurs unless you arelegally incapacitated.

    Physical Examination and Autopsy At our expense, we havethe right to have you examined as often as necessary whilea claim is pending. At our expense, we may require anautopsy unless the law or your religion forbids it.

    Legal Actions No legal action may be brought to recover onthe plan within 60 days after written proof of loss has beengiven. No such action will be brought after three years fromthe time written proof of loss is required to be given. If atime limit of the plan is less than allowed by the laws of theState where you live, the limit is extended to meet theminimum time allowed by such law.

    Payment of Claims Benefits for loss of life will be paid toyour estate, or if no estate, to your beneficiary. All otherbenefits are paid directly to you, unless otherwise directed.Any accrued benefits unpaid at your death will be paid toyour estate, or if no estate, to your beneficiary. If you haveassigned your benefits, we will honor the assignment if asigned copy has been filed with us. We are not responsiblefor the validity of any assignment.
